About Inner Richmond

Inner Richmond in San Francisco is a vibrant neighborhood nestled between The Presidio and Golden Gate Park, offering residents ample opportunities for outdoor activities and cultural experiences. The area is known for its diverse dining scene, featuring Irish, Vietnamese, and Chinese cuisine, with popular spots like D&A Café and Café Bunn Mi on Clement Street. The neighborhood is highly walkable, with easy access to the expansive trails and scenic views of both parks. Golden Gate Park hosts the California Academy of Sciences and de Young Museum, while The Presidio offers hiking trails, panoramic city views, and beaches. Inner Richmond is served by the well-regarded San Francisco Unified School District, including Sutro Elementary, Roosevelt Middle School, and George Washington High School, all of which have high ratings. The neighborhood features storybook and craftsman homes, often with first-floor garages and bay windows. Public transportation is convenient, with Muni bus stops providing routes to downtown and the financial district. Major thoroughfares like Park Presidio Boulevard and Interstate 80 offer easy access to Marin County and Oakland, respectively, while San Francisco International Airport is about 15 miles away. Residents can also enjoy various events at The Presidio, such as pop-up concerts, nature talks, and the annual San Francisco Film Fest. The neighborhood is considered safer than the national average, making it a desirable place to live.
